A serene pastoral scene by Pieter Gerardus van Os, featuring cattle, sheep, and figures resting in a soft, atmospheric Dutch countryside.
Pieter Gerardus van Os, a member of a prominent Dutch family of painters, produced this work during a period when the pastoral tradition remained a primary focus for artists in the Netherlands. The composition follows the conventions of the Dutch Italianate style, which prioritises a sense of atmospheric depth and a harmonious relationship between human figures and their environment.
In the foreground, a group of cattle and sheep rests near a small pool of water, while a shepherd and a young woman interact in the shade of a birch tree. The middle ground features a gentle slope covered in dense foliage, leading the eye towards a distant, hazy horizon. Van Os employs a soft, diffused light that suggests the quiet atmosphere of a summer afternoon. The sky occupies a significant portion of the canvas, filled with light, billowing clouds that provide a sense of scale to the rural scene.
Technically, the painting demonstrates the artist's precision in rendering animal anatomy and textures, from the coarse wool of the sheep to the smooth hide of the standing cow. The palette is dominated by earthy tones, including ochre, muted greens, and soft greys, which unify the various elements of the composition. This work reflects the 19th-century interest in idealised rural life, a theme that allowed artists to explore light and texture within a controlled, serene setting. The inclusion of a small caravan of travellers on the hillside adds a subtle narrative element, suggesting the passage of time and the movement of people through the countryside.
